·nextjs-client-cookie-pattern
</>

nextjs-client-cookie-pattern

Шаблон для клиентских компонентов, вызывающих действия сервера для установки файлов cookie в Next.js. Охватывает двухфайловый шаблон клиентского компонента с взаимодействием с пользователем (onClick, отправка формы), который вызывает действие сервера для изменения файлов cookie. Используйте при создании таких функций, как аутентификация, настройки или управление сеансами, где триггеры на стороне клиента должны устанавливать/изменять файлы cookie на стороне сервера.

82Установки·2Тренд·@wsimmonds

Установка

$npx skills add https://github.com/wsimmonds/claude-nextjs-skills --skill nextjs-client-cookie-pattern

Как установить nextjs-client-cookie-pattern

Быстро установите AI-навык nextjs-client-cookie-pattern в вашу среду разработки через командную строку

  1. Откройте терминал: Откройте терминал или инструмент командной строки (Terminal, iTerm, Windows Terminal и т.д.)
  2. Выполните команду установки: Скопируйте и выполните эту команду: npx skills add https://github.com/wsimmonds/claude-nextjs-skills --skill nextjs-client-cookie-pattern
  3. Проверьте установку: После установки навык будет автоматически настроен в вашей AI-среде разработки и готов к использованию в Claude Code, Cursor или OpenClaw

Источник: wsimmonds/claude-nextjs-skills.

This pattern handles a common Next.js requirement: client-side interaction (button click) that needs to set server-side cookies.

Can't client components set cookies directly? No. Client components run in the browser, and modern browsers restrict cookie manipulation for security. Server actions run on the server where cookie-setting is allowed.

Why not use a Route Handler (API route)? You can! But server actions are simpler and more integrated with the Next.js App Router pattern.

Шаблон для клиентских компонентов, вызывающих действия сервера для установки файлов cookie в Next.js. Охватывает двухфайловый шаблон клиентского компонента с взаимодействием с пользователем (onClick, отправка формы), который вызывает действие сервера для изменения файлов cookie. Используйте при создании таких функций, как аутентификация, настройки или управление сеансами, где триггеры на стороне клиента должны устанавливать/изменять файлы cookie на стороне сервера. Источник: wsimmonds/claude-nextjs-skills.

Факты (для цитирования)

Стабильные поля и команды для ссылок в AI/поиске.

Команда установки
npx skills add https://github.com/wsimmonds/claude-nextjs-skills --skill nextjs-client-cookie-pattern
Категория
</>Разработка
Проверено
Впервые замечено
2026-02-01
Обновлено
2026-03-10

Browse more skills from wsimmonds/claude-nextjs-skills

Короткие ответы

Что такое nextjs-client-cookie-pattern?

Шаблон для клиентских компонентов, вызывающих действия сервера для установки файлов cookie в Next.js. Охватывает двухфайловый шаблон клиентского компонента с взаимодействием с пользователем (onClick, отправка формы), который вызывает действие сервера для изменения файлов cookie. Используйте при создании таких функций, как аутентификация, настройки или управление сеансами, где триггеры на стороне клиента должны устанавливать/изменять файлы cookie на стороне сервера. Источник: wsimmonds/claude-nextjs-skills.

Как установить nextjs-client-cookie-pattern?

Откройте терминал или инструмент командной строки (Terminal, iTerm, Windows Terminal и т.д.) Скопируйте и выполните эту команду: npx skills add https://github.com/wsimmonds/claude-nextjs-skills --skill nextjs-client-cookie-pattern После установки навык будет автоматически настроен в вашей AI-среде разработки и готов к использованию в Claude Code, Cursor или OpenClaw

Где находится исходный репозиторий?

https://github.com/wsimmonds/claude-nextjs-skills